Abstract
An attempt is made to interpret the symmetric spontaneous fission of the heavy actinides, e.g. of 258Fm, according to the general scheme developed by the authors [1] in the case of asymmetric fission. This attempt leads to observations suggesting that this kind of symmetric fission occurs for nuclei in which the initial formation of a cluster within the valence shells of the fissioning nucleus yields an energy higher than the threshold for formation of a pion. It is also suggested that this mode of fission could be related to a phase change of nuclear matter.
